Introduction

Reliance Jio launched a recharge plan at Rs 1958, offering 365 days (a year) of uninterrupted service that focuses on calling and SMS benefits without data allocation. This plan is launched under TRAI (Telecom Regulatory Authority of India) guidelines, which mandate that telecom operators provide affordable voice-only plans for users using most voice calls and SMS services. This plan is suitable for senior citizens who use basic mobile phones, such as phones, to make calls and check messages.

  1. How do I know if my plan is valid?

Check your plan validity through:

  • MyJio app: Open the app > My Plans section.
  • Dial code: Dial 1299 from your Jio number.
  • SMS: Send MYPLAN to 199.
